Shahid now on KONKA smart TVs
December 7, 2022
Technology company KONKA Group and MBC Group, a media company in the MENA region, have announced a strategic partnership that will allow all KONKA Android (version 11 and up) and webOS smart television users in MENA countries to quickly access MBC’s Shahid, the Arabic streaming platform, via the homepage launch bar or the Shahid App.
Kobe Liao, General Manager of International Business Division, KONKA, said: “In recent years, KONKA has actively expanded its international reach while prioritising offering localised services through increased investment in after-sales service teams and closer collaboration with local business partners. The new strategic cooperation with Shahid will empower both sides to achieve mutually beneficial results. Meanwhile, KONKA will also continue to optimise product layout and strengthen product innovation and creation for more users in the region.”
Shahid offers premium content to Arab families, including binge worthy exclusive Shahid Original Series; Shahid Premieres; Arabic movies fresh off the box-office; live TV channels HD; FAST Channels, as well as sports and international offerings.
